description 碩士 === 國立彰化師範大學 === 工業教育與技術學系 === 105 === The aim of this study is to understand vocational high school teachers’ intention of mobile learning via cloud technology - take Podcast teaching platform for example. Based on the Unified Theory of Acceptance and Use Technology (UTAUT), this study explored the correlation among the teachers’ intention in four aspects - the performance expectancy, the effort expectancy, the social influence, and the facilitating conditions. In addition, this study also analyzed the differences through the following variables - the gender, the age, the teaching seniority, the position, the academic background, the users’ experience, and the users’ voluntariness. The subjects in the study were the public and private vocational high school teachers who used Podcast teaching platform. 589 effective questionnaires were collected and analyzed with some statistical methods, such as Descriptive Statistics, Percentage, Average, Standard Deviation, Independent-Sample t Test, one-way ANOVA, and Pearson Product-Moment Correlation Coefficient. According to the results, the study found the six main points below. 1. The vocational high school teachers’ intention was indeed affected by the facilitating conditions, especially in the categories of gender, age, position, and users’ experience. As for the categories of teaching seniority and academic background, there were no significant differences. 2. The vocational high school teachers’ intention was indeed affected by the effort expectancy, especially in the categories of gender, age, position, and users’ experience. As for the categories of teaching seniority and academic background, there were no significant differences. 3. The vocational high school teachers’ intention was indeed affected by the social influence, especially in the categories of gender, teaching seniority, users’ experience, and users’ voluntariness. As for the categories of age, position, and academic background, there were no significant differences. 4. The vocational high school teachers’ intention was indeed affected by the facilitating conditions, especially in the categories of gender, age, position, and users’ experience. As for the categories of teaching seniority and academic background, there were no significant differences. 5. In the aspects of performance expectancy, effort expectancy, social influence, and facilitating conditions, the correlation is above moderately correlated in the vocational high school teachers’ intention of using Podcast teaching platform. 6. The correlation between vocational high school teachers' intention and behavior of using Podcast teaching platform via cloud technology is modestly correlated.
